If you had them install the wheels the last time, then they're partly to blame.

the problem is that I believe it states in the sears paperwork that you're supposed to retighten the lugs after 50 or so miles--- so them leaving them loose is also your responsibility to check.

but if they were the last place that touched the wheels, I would definitely make sure the manager knows that and do what you can to have them help you in the repair/replacement costs.
